Photopolymerization is generally used in stereolithography to create a stable component from a liquid. Inkjet printer programs such as Objet PolyJet method spray photopolymer elements on to a Construct tray in ultra-skinny levels (concerning sixteen and 30 µm) right until the aspect is accomplished. Just about every photopolymer layer is cured with UV gentle right after it's jetted, developing completely cured styles which can be handled and used promptly, without having put up-curing.

AM procedures for steel sintering or melting (like selective laser sintering, immediate steel laser sintering, and selective laser melting) commonly went by their own personal personal names in the nineteen eighties and nineties. At time, all metalworking was done by processes that we now get in touch with non-additive (casting, fabrication, stamping, and machining); Though a good amount of automation was placed on People systems (including by robotic welding and CNC), the thought of a Resource or head transferring by way of a 3D perform envelope reworking a mass of Uncooked material into a preferred shape having a toolpath was associated in metalworking only with processes that taken out metallic (as an alternative to introducing it), for example CNC milling, CNC EDM, and a lot of Some others.
